    Alternative Terror
    War Tanks rolled over to
    Jenin and its Refugee Camp
    As battlefields in a minute
    Clouds of black smokes belched
    From the nozzle of the missiles
    Turned the dwellings into debris
    And lives breathe under rubble
    Still desires of living
    That will never be fulfilled
    Sighing are heard in the air
    Unseen ghosts are roaming freely
    Searching their brotherhoods
    Living or dead
    Souls are still weeping bitterly
    With sorrows that never end
    In the war turned atmosphere
    Flying high in the sky appeared
    The hungry vultures that smell
    Odors of rotten human flesh
    As if the open graveyards
    To wipe the terrors and even its ghosts
    Out of the worldly atmosphere
    Reassuring pure peace
    In every people’s mind
    Is’t the rebirth of terror
    Or alternative terror ?
    © Pushpa Ratna Tuladhar.

Peace is a daily, a weekly, a monthly process, gradually changing opinions, slowly eroding old barriers, quietly building new structures. And however undramatic the pursuit of peace, the pursuit must go on.

by John Fitzgerald Kennedy Found in: Peace Quotes,

Our commander said
the Viet Cong are farmers
by day.. guerillas by night.
Look for those who are tired.
So anyone who yawned
was getting popped.

by Seymour Hersh Found in: Peace Quotes,
